They are typically made of two panes (although quadruple or triple glass with three or more panes may be purchased) of insulated glass separated by the spacer. The frame for the spacer is made of tube or foam and is fixed to the two panes using an initial sealing agent. The spacer frame is filled with inert gases like Krypton and argon to enhance the thermal performance.

If a window has cracks or gaps, it will reduce the noise reduction that could be attained. This is because air leakage can be able to pass through these gaps, allowing loud noises into the home. This is particularly relevant for windows that are older or have been installed poorly. Newly sealed windows that have more secure seals can lessen the amount of noise that can be heard in the home.

Additionally using different thicknesses of glass within a triple or double glazed unit can enhance noise reduction. This is because different glass thicknesses block or block different frequencies of noise. Different thicknesses will also act as a barrier to heat, which means that the overall effect is a greater reduction of noise and thermal transmission.
